WebJan 11, 2024 · Maybe that still can be used to measure the flow in a pipe. $\endgroup$ – Orbit. Jan 12, 2024 at 12:41 ... Pressure drop is the driving force for fluid flow. For rigid pipe, if you can measure the pressure at two different horizontal points, the flow direction will be from higher pressure to lower pressure. WebThe electronic–hydraulic analogy (derisively referred to as the drain-pipe theory by Oliver Lodge) is the most widely used analogy for "electron fluid" in a metal conductor.Since electric current is invisible and the processes in play in electronics are often difficult to demonstrate, the various electronic components are represented by hydraulic equivalents. Ten diameters of pipe between the pump suction and … WebThe Pipe Wall. A fluid flowing through a pipe contacts the pipe wall. The pipe wall has surface roughness. The amount of roughness affects the drag on the fluid.
